-/**
- * Constants for Alphabetic Index Label Types.
- * The form of these enum constants anticipates having a plain C API
- * for Alphabetic Indexes that will also use them.
- * @stable ICU 4.8
- */
-typedef enum UAlphabeticIndexLabelType {
- /**
- * Normal Label, typically the starting letter of the names
- * in the bucket with this label.
- * @stable ICU 4.8
- */
- U_ALPHAINDEX_NORMAL = 0,
-
- /**
- * Undeflow Label. The bucket with this label contains names
- * in scripts that sort before any of the bucket labels in this index.
- * @stable ICU 4.8
- */
- U_ALPHAINDEX_UNDERFLOW = 1,
-
- /**
- * Inflow Label. The bucket with this label contains names
- * in scripts that sort between two of the bucket labels in this index.
- * Inflow labels are created when an index contains normal labels for
- * multiple scripts, and skips other scripts that sort between some of the
- * included scripts.
- * @stable ICU 4.8
- */
- U_ALPHAINDEX_INFLOW = 2,
-
- /**
- * Overflow Label. Te bucket with this label contains names in scripts
- * that sort after all of the bucket labels in this index.
- * @stable ICU 4.8
- */
- U_ALPHAINDEX_OVERFLOW = 3
-} UAlphabeticIndexLabelType;

-/**
- * AlphabeticIndex supports the creation of a UI index appropriate for a given language.
- * It can support either direct use, or use with a client that doesn't support localized collation.
- * The following is an example of what an index might look like in a UI:
- *
- * <pre>
- * <b>... A B C D E F G H I J K L M N O P Q R S T U V W X Y Z ...</b>
- *
- * <b>A</b>
- * Addison
- * Albertson
- * Azensky
- * <b>B</b>
- * Baker
- * ...
- * </pre>
- *
- * The class can generate a list of labels for use as a UI "index", that is, a list of
- * clickable characters (or character sequences) that allow the user to see a segment
- * (bucket) of a larger "target" list. That is, each label corresponds to a bucket in
- * the target list, where everything in the bucket is greater than or equal to the character
- * (according to the locale's collation). Strings can be added to the index;
- * they will be in sorted order in the right bucket.
- * <p>
- * The class also supports having buckets for strings before the first (underflow),
- * after the last (overflow), and between scripts (inflow). For example, if the index
- * is constructed with labels for Russian and English, Greek characters would fall
- * into an inflow bucket between the other two scripts.
- * <p>
- * The AlphabeticIndex class is not intended for public subclassing.
- *
- * <p><em>Note:</em> If you expect to have a lot of ASCII or Latin characters
- * as well as characters from the user's language,
- * then it is a good idea to call addLabels(Locale::getEnglish(), status).</p>
- *
- * <h2>Direct Use</h2>
- * <p>The following shows an example of building an index directly.
- * The "show..." methods below are just to illustrate usage.
- *
- * <pre>
- * // Create a simple index. "Item" is assumed to be an application
- * // defined type that the application's UI and other processing knows about,
- * // and that has a name.
- *
- * UErrorCode status = U_ZERO_ERROR;
- * AlphabeticIndex index = new AlphabeticIndex(desiredLocale, status);
- * index->addLabels(additionalLocale, status);
- * for (Item *item in some source of Items ) {
- * index->addRecord(item->name(), item, status);
- * }
- * ...
- * // Show index at top. We could skip or gray out empty buckets
- *
- * while (index->nextBucket(status)) {
- * if (showAll || index->getBucketRecordCount() != 0) {
- * showLabelAtTop(UI, index->getBucketLabel());
- * }
- * }
- * ...
- * // Show the buckets with their contents, skipping empty buckets
- *
- * index->resetBucketIterator(status);
- * while (index->nextBucket(status)) {
- * if (index->getBucketRecordCount() != 0) {
- * showLabelInList(UI, index->getBucketLabel());
- * while (index->nextRecord(status)) {
- * showIndexedItem(UI, static_cast<Item *>(index->getRecordData()))
- * </pre>
- *
- * The caller can build different UIs using this class.
- * For example, an index character could be omitted or grayed-out
- * if its bucket is empty. Small buckets could also be combined based on size, such as:
- *
- * <pre>
- * <b>... A-F G-N O-Z ...</b>
- * </pre>
- *
- * <h2>Client Support</h2>
- * <p>Callers can also use the AlphabeticIndex::ImmutableIndex, or the AlphabeticIndex itself,
- * to support sorting on a client that doesn't support AlphabeticIndex functionality.
- *
- * <p>The ImmutableIndex is both immutable and thread-safe.
- * The corresponding AlphabeticIndex methods are not thread-safe because
- * they "lazily" build the index buckets.
- * <ul>
- * <li>ImmutableIndex.getBucket(index) provides random access to all
- * buckets and their labels and label types.
- * <li>The AlphabeticIndex bucket iterator or ImmutableIndex.getBucket(0..getBucketCount-1)
- * can be used to get a list of the labels,
- * such as "...", "A", "B",..., and send that list to the client.
- * <li>When the client has a new name, it sends that name to the server.
- * The server needs to call the following methods,
- * and communicate the bucketIndex and collationKey back to the client.
- *
- * <pre>
- * int32_t bucketIndex = index.getBucketIndex(name, status);
- * const UnicodeString &label = immutableIndex.getBucket(bucketIndex)->getLabel(); // optional
- * int32_t skLength = collator.getSortKey(name, sk, skCapacity);
- * </pre>
- *
- * <li>The client would put the name (and associated information) into its bucket for bucketIndex. The sort key sk is a
- * sequence of bytes that can be compared with a binary compare, and produce the right localized result.</li>
- * </ul>
- *
- * @stable ICU 4.8
- */
